I used to load for 300 RUM which used powder charges in the 80-100 grain range depending on powder and bullet weight.
When reading about accuracy in all those big magnums I remember reading that you should look at the powder measure consistency as a percent of the total charge.
1/10 of a grain in a precision 223 load that uses 22-26 grains of powder is a lot larger percentage of the overall weight than 1/10 of a grain in a 100 grain charge.
They of course shot for the highest accuracy possible but when loading to find OCW they said that jumping up in 1/10 or 3/10 or even 1/2 grain increments was way too fine of an adjustment to finding nodes.

Depends on the powder or the composition of the powder.
Its either 7 or 800X that meters like oatmeal for me. Charge weights were all over the place.
Bullseye and 231 just flow like water. Little finer grain.

RL15 was the same thing. The ball and stick stuff, I could hear a crunch like it was shearing the sticks in two.
That stuff I would weigh out on a scale. It was painful, but I also didn't have a dispenser and a trickler.

I use TiteGroup, WST, and Bullseye powders with a Dillon powder measure. My scale is a GemPro 500 that measures out to 0.05 grains. I verify the weight of 4 cartridges for every 100 I load. Three are random, and the 4th is every time the low primer warning goes off. I keep track of each weight through the loading session, and across multiple sessions (yes, just a touch of OCD). Since all the powders I use are noted for being very good even measuring powders, I'm never off by more than +/- 0.10 gr.

That's plenty good for action pistol shooting where the smaller targets may be 6 inch steel at 35 feet.

I don't load any rifle calibers so I don't know if that's an acceptable range or not. I would guess that unless it's super precision, it would be fine because you're using so much more powder that 0.10 would be a much lower percentage difference. Probably be fine for .223 or .308 to whack steel at 100 yards all day long.

Just wrapped up loading all the PPU .308 brass I could find in my stash. Should keep the 308 M1 supplied for a few of the offhand matches. I had a handful of PPU 7.62 NATO brass and half expected it to be the same brass with a different head stamp. Not true! PPU indeed makes each according to spec and the 7.62 brass is heavier. Run through the same sizing dies and setting, I can feel the neck pressure is higher for the 7.62 when seating.

Since it's a small qty, I'll use the 7.62 for sighting in and maybe check POI with a couple .308's before wrapping it up.
